Preparing the Surface for Application

Proper surface preparation is the most critical factor in achieving a long-lasting finish with rustoleum floor paint from Home Depot. Concrete must be thoroughly cleaned to remove grease, oil, and any existing peeling coatings. Professionals often recommend using a degreaser and a stiff scrub brush to ensure the pores of the concrete are open and ready to bond. Any cracks or deep stains should be addressed with a suitable filler to create a level substrate that prevents visible defects in the final layer.

Moisture control is another essential element of preparation that cannot be overlooked. You should test the slab for moisture using a plastic sheet or a specific meter before proceeding. If vapor pressure is high, applying a vapor-blocking primer is necessary to prevent bubbling or delamination. Taking the time to dry the area with fans or dehumidifiers will significantly increase the lifespan of the decorative floor system.

Start the process by sweeping or vacuuming the area to remove loose debris and dust. Next, apply a concrete cleaner or degreaser to eliminate built-up oils and residues that could block adhesion. For best results, use a scrubber or push broom to work the solution deep into the surface, then rinse thoroughly with clean water. Allow the slab to dry completely, which may take several days depending on humidity and temperature.

Pressure washing is an effective method for preparing large areas, as it can strip old dirt and open the pores of the concrete. Make sure to use a wide fan tip to avoid gouging the surface. Once the water runs clear and the floor is dry, inspect the slab for any remaining stains or glossy spots that might require spot treatment. A well-prepared surface ensures that the decorative flakes in the rustoleum system adhere evenly.

Minor cracks should be filled with a flexible concrete patching compound that can move with the substrate. For larger holes or divots, a polymer-modified filler is ideal because it provides a durable, seamless transition. You should feather the edges of the repair to blend seamlessly with the surrounding area. Allowing ample curing time prevents the new fill from breaking loose after the paint is applied.

It is also wise to check for any loose material or spalling where the top layer of concrete has broken away. Using a wire brush to remove loose particles and then sealing the area with a bonding agent will create a solid foundation. Addressing these issues before rolling on the paint ensures a uniform appearance and prevents moisture from seeping underneath the coating.

Rolling and Flaking Techniques

Use a short-nap roller to apply a thin, even layer of the base color, moving in the direction of the grain for consistent coverage. Avoid over-rolling, which can introduce bubbles or streaks into the finish. Once the first coat is down, you can apply a second coat and immediately broadcast the decorative flakes across the surface. The weight of the flakes will cause them to sink slightly into the tacky paint, creating a durable textured look.

Work in small areas to prevent the paint from skinning over before the flakes are distributed. The texture created by the flakes provides traction underfoot and masks minor surface wear. This technique is especially useful in garages and workshops where functionality is as important as appearance.

Drying and Cure Times

After application, it is essential to allow the initial drying period before walking on the surface, which is usually around 4 to 6 hours. However, the full cure time can extend up to a week, during which you should avoid heavy furniture or vehicle traffic. Keeping the area ventilated at moderate temperature helps the chemicals bond correctly and prevents a cloudy appearance. Patience during this phase results in a harder, more resilient finish.

Check the manufacturer’s specific instructions regarding recoat times if you are using additional protective topcoats. Some systems may benefit from a clear urethane sealer that adds extra shine and chemical resistance. Following these guidelines ensures that the vibrant color and decorative flakes remain intact for years.

Color Selection and Coordination

When selecting a color, consider the mood you want to set in the room. Light colors open up a space and make it feel larger, while dark colors add sophistication and depth. Coordinating the floor with nearby walls or cabinetry creates a sense of continuity throughout the home. The flakes in the paint can either blend in for a subtle texture or pop with contrast to highlight the pattern.

It is also practical to choose a color that hides dirt and wear effectively. Medium and dark tones are forgiving when it comes to stains, whereas white or light gray may show messes more quickly. Choosing a style that fits your lifestyle ensures that your beautiful new floor remains functional for daily use.

Pattern and Texture Ideas

For a unique touch, you can tape off sections of the floor to create sharp geometric patterns before applying the second coat and flakes. This method allows you to incorporate stripes or checkerboard effects that draw the eye. Alternatively, you can sprinkle flakes densely for a textured, non-slip surface that is ideal for workshop areas or entryways.

Stenciling is another advanced technique that works well with this type of coating. You can place a stencil on the wet paint and lightly spray a contrasting color over it to create logos or motifs. These design possibilities ensure that your floor is not just a protective layer, but a defining feature of the room.
